| Правила | Регистрация | Пользователи | Поиск | Сообщения за день | Все разделы прочитаны |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> Помогите с _wblock

Помогите с _wblock

Ответ
Поиск в этой теме
Непрочитано 20.11.2003, 14:48 #1
Помогите с _wblock
я
 
Сообщений: n/a

Здравствуйте! Помогите, пожалуйста, с командой wblock. Задание такое: нарисовать в автокаде рисунок, зайти в автолисп и создать блок из этого рисунка, т.е. загрузив программку и выделив объекты, сохранить данный новый примитив в текущий каталог.
Просмотров: 5483
 
Непрочитано 20.11.2003, 15:31
#2


 
Сообщений: n/a


оффтопик:
может, проще пользоваться designcenter (2002) или toolpalettes (2004)?
 
 
Непрочитано 20.11.2003, 17:05
#3
vk

сисадмин
 
Регистрация: 26.08.2003
Самара
Сообщений: 1,022
<phrase 1=


Не соображу, что делать Лиспом.... Выполнить пару (command...) и все?
vk вне форума  
 
Непрочитано 20.11.2003, 18:30
#4
я


 
Сообщений: n/a


У меня Автокад2000, дали только задание и сказали :"Делайте!". Ни лекций, ни чего. В книгах описывается, как создавать примитив в самом автокаде (в командной строке) и все. Возможно надо только пару (command...), но вопрос: каких? Я в этом полный ламмер.
 
 
Непрочитано 20.11.2003, 20:11
#5
vk

сисадмин
 
Регистрация: 26.08.2003
Самара
Сообщений: 1,022
<phrase 1=


Ваш преп, прям зверь какой-то.... Мог бы и подсказать, что
создать блок - _.block
сохранить блок как внешний файл - _.wblock

Вот и вся пара команд... И что тут делать Автолиспом? Или я не разобрался в первом постинге....
vk вне форума  
 
Непрочитано 21.11.2003, 13:17
#6
D r o n T


 
Сообщений: n/a


когда- то я вот что себе сделал:

Код:
[Выделить все]
(defun C:pr ()

     (setq PAT "C:/Program Files/ACAD2000/TEXNO2/")
     (princ "создание блока перехода треугольником\nвыбор объектов")
     (setq NE (ssget)
      )
     (setq T1 (getpoint "\n>широкая")
      )
     (setq T2 (getpoint "\n>узкая")
      )
     (setq TIP (getstring "\n>типоразмер")
      )
     (setq TIP1 (strcat "2w" TIP "t1")
      )
     (setq PT1 (strcat PAT TIP1)
      )
     (setq TIP2 (strcat "2w" TIP "t2")
      )
     (setq PT2 (strcat PAT TIP2)
      )
     (command "block" TIP1 T1 NE "")
     (command "wblock" PT1 (eval TIP1))
     (command "undo" 2)
     (command "block" TIP2 T2 NE "")
     (command "wblock" PT2 (eval TIP2))
суть в том что он два блока пишет, две точки задаёшь для чего.
 
 
Непрочитано 04.12.2003, 10:36
#7
я


 
Сообщений: n/a


Всем огромное спасибо. Прграмка прошла на ура
 
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> Программирование > Помогите с _wblock

Размещение рекламы
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ск